The Emergence of Decentralized Physical Infrastructure Networks (DePIN)
At the core of this transformation are Decentralized Physical Infrastructure Networks (DePIN). DePIN projects aim to utilize physical assets like GPUs, servers, and even smartphones in a decentralized manner. By integrating these assets into blockchain networks, DePIN platforms can offer a new model of resource sharing that is both efficient and lucrative for participants.
DePINs are built on the principles of decentralization, ensuring that no single entity has control over the network. This not only enhances security but also promotes trust among users. In the context of GPU sharing, DePIN projects are paving the way for a more inclusive and sustainable model of computing resource allocation.

1. Smart Contracts and Blockchain Integration
Smart contracts are at the heart of decentralized GPU sharing. These self-executing contracts with the terms of the agreement directly written into code ensure that transactions are transparent, secure, and automated. Blockchain integration provides the necessary infrastructure for these smart contracts to function seamlessly, enabling trustless and decentralized operations.
2. Advanced Matching Algorithms
Efficient allocation of GPU resources is crucial for the success of DePIN projects. Advanced matching algorithms play a pivotal role in this aspect. By analyzing real-time demand and supply data, these algorithms optimize GPU allocation, ensuring that users get the best possible deals while sharers are fairly compensated.
3. Energy Efficiency and Sustainability
One of the significant advantages of decentralized GPU sharing is its potential to enhance energy efficiency. By utilizing idle GPU resources, these projects reduce the need for new, energy-intensive data centers. This not only lowers operational costs but also contributes to a more sustainable computing future.
